Handover for the weekly eng sync: I'm transferring ownership of Duskrunner, our nightly backfill scheduler, to Priya. Current state: all jobs healthy except the ledger-reconciliation backfill, which retries once nightly due to a slow upstream from the Kestwick warehouse. Retry logic, window sizing, and concurrency caps were all tuned carefully last quarter — please don't change them without a load test. For full transparency at the sync, the production instance runs with these configuration values.

settings of hawep-kadug:
RALAEL_HOST=ralael.tolvaqlabs.internal
RALAEL_PORT=9000

Subject: Insurance Renewal — Action Needed

Team,

Our commercial policy with Averleigh Mutual renews at quarter-end. The quoted premium rises 11%, reflecting last year's warehouse claim in Pellbrook. Finance should verify the updated asset schedule and confirm coverage limits for the new Farrow Lane facility before we countersign. I'd like sign-off by Friday. Please review the confidential planning context below before responding.

confidential, kagep-kahof: Druokax Systems plans to lower the Ulaath list price by 53 percent in March.

**Order cutoff enforcement.** Crumbline's bakery orders lock at 14:00 local store time; the cutoff is evaluated server-side against the store's timezone record, never the client clock. If a reviewer sees cutoff logic duplicated in the mobile layer, flag it — the server check is authoritative and the client copy is display-only. Edge case: stores spanning a DST change re-evaluate at next sync. Verify behavior against the build noted below.

build token for yajof-bajof: htk31_506ff1188f74596b5bb2eec94edc43c

- [ ] **Step 7: Breaker override escrow.** After sealing the signing keys for the Tallgrove upstream API circuit breaker, confirm the support team can force the breaker open during a full outage. The override bundle lives in the sealed escrow drawer and is useless without its unlock phrase. Two ceremony witnesses must initial this step before proceeding. The escrow bundle is decrypted with the recovery passphrase that follows.

vault phrase of kahip-kahop = holath-quenmir